Breaking Down the Features of Safariland 6285 1.50″ Belt Drop, Level II Retention Holster – Plain Black, Left Hand 6285-842-62

Specifications

The Safariland 6285 1.50″ Belt Drop, Level II Retention Holster – Plain Black, Left Hand 6285-842-62 is a duty holster designed for left-handed users, featuring a Level II retention system. It is specifically molded to fit the Smith & Wesson SW99 with an ITI M5 Light.

Key specifications include a 1.50″ (38mm) belt drop, SLS (Self-Locking System), a top draw design, and a straight drop cant. The finish is plain black, and it’s categorized as a duty holster.

These specifications are vital for duty use. The belt drop offers comfortable carry, and the SLS provides essential security.

Accessories and Customization Options

The Safariland 6285 is designed to be used with a standard 1.5″ duty belt. While it doesn’t come with a wide array of accessories, it is compatible with various Safariland mounting options, allowing for customization of ride height and cant.

The holster’s design is specifically molded for the Smith & Wesson SW99 with an ITI M5 Light, which limits its compatibility with other firearms and light combinations. While there are not many “accessories” for the holster itself, the ability to adjust cant and ride height via Safariland’s mounting system allows for personalized ergonomics.
